52 - MANUFACTURING, M
The Manufacturing (M) zoning district is intended to be applied to areas suitable for commercial and manufacturing uses that are typically incompatible in other zoning districts, along with nonresidential uses that are considered compatible with these uses. Uses permitted by this chapter shall not be detrimental to the public health, safety, and general welfare by reason of odor, smoke, gas, dust, vibration, or noise, nor deemed to be exceptional fire of explosion hazards. The M district is consistent with the Industrial land use designation.

Subject to issuance of a building permit, business license, and/or other required permits, none but the following uses, or uses which in the opinion of the Planning Commission are similar, will be allowed as principally permitted uses in the M zoning district:
A.
Animal boarding, animal grooming, animal hospitals, and veterinary offices.
B.
Automobile and vehicle sales and rental.
C.
Automobile service stations, no fuel sales.
D.
Building material stores and yards.
E.
Car washing and detailing.
F.
Clothing and fabric product manufacturing.
G.
Craft food and beverage production, alcohol with use permit.
H.
Equipment sales and rental.
I.
Furniture and fixtures manufacturing.
J.
Garden centers and plant nurseries.
K.
Handcraft industries.
L.
Indoor storage facilities.
M.
Metal products fabrication, machine/welding shops.
N.
Mixed-use developments of two (2) or more uses permitted pursuant to this chapter.
O.
Paper product manufacturing.
P.
Printing and publishing.
Q.
Public and quasi-public facilities.
R.
Small equipment maintenance and repair.
S.
Wholesale businesses.

When established or constructed concurrently with or subsequent to the principally permitted use, the following uses are permitted in the M zoning district subject to issuance of a building permit, business license, or other required permit(s):
A.
Mobile food sales pursuant to Chapter 17.112 (Mobile Food Sales).
B.
Signs pursuant to Chapter 17.80 (Signs).
C.
Uncovered storage for allowable uses on the rear half of the lot if screened by solid fencing a minimum of six (6) feet in height.
D.
Usual and customary structures associated with a principally permitted use, including fences and walls pursuant to Section 17.92.120 (Fences, walls, hedges, and equivalent screening).

The following uses are permitted in the M zoning district upon approval and validation of a conditional use permit, in addition to any other permits or licenses required for the use:
A.
Ambulance service.
B.
Automobile service stations that include fuel sales.
C.
Chemical product manufacturing.
D.
Concrete batching or ready-mix concrete manufacturing.
E.
Equipment and material storage yards.
F.
Food and beverage manufacturing.
G.
Fuel storage and distribution.
H.
Glass product manufacturing.
I.
Heliports.
J.
Lumber and wood product processing facilities.
K.
Off-site parking and shared parking facilities pursuant to Chapter 17.76 (Off-street parking).
L.
Outdoor storage facilities.
M.
Recycling facilities.
N.
Restricted retail sales.
O.
Retail food establishments.
P.
Retail sales.
Q.
Salvage yards.
R.
Stone product manufacturing.
S.
Other uses similar to those listed in this section.
